Change Your Perceptions
How you perceive your experiences in life determines your thoughts and so the actions (if any) you take. Right, put it this way, you’re driving to the office one morning and matey boy in the flash car next to you forces his way into traffic and doesn’t even have the decency to look apologetic.Reality 1: He’s a prick and doesn’t care about anyone in life. He drives a flash car and thinks he’s all that. He deserves to be run off the road and skinned before being hung up by his toenails.
Reality 2: He’s clearly in a rush. Maybe he has a big meeting this morning. Maybe his family are in distress. Maybe he has just been made redundant and he’s struggling to cope.
Did you feel a different reaction in you when you read those two different statements? By simply changing your view (perception) of an experience it changes what you think and how you feel. Try it for yourself.
How about if your boss passes you over for a promotion and gives it to someone else? How would you perceive that situation? Does your boss hate you? Or are they actually under pressure from somewhere above you? Is there a previous arrangement that you don’t know about that’s influenced their decision?
Your perceptions of a situation or an experience are key to what you think and do. Most of us just stick to habitual perceptions that lead us to automatic responses to stuff.
If you fancy changing your life in 5 minutes then start becoming more aware of how you perceive the things that happen in your life and catch yourself when you feel like you’re making a judgement call on something or someone. Doing that can literally change your life in a heartbeat.
